Wallpaper and Lock Screen Photos
You can display a photo in the wallpaper background of the Lock screen and Home screen. You can choose from several wallpaper pictures included with iPad, or you can use a photo of your own.
Set a photo as screen wallpaper:
1 Choose any photo and tap , then tap Use As Wallpaper.
2 Drag to pan the photo, or pinch the photo to zoom in or out, until it looks the way you want. Keep in mind that the image will be displayed in both portrait and landscape orientation but won’t rotate.
3 Tap Set Wallpaper. Then tap to use the image as wallpaper for the Home screen, on the Lock screen, or both.
To choose from several wallpaper pictures included with iPad, go to Settings > Brightness & Wallpaper.
The iPhone 3G can only use wallpaper/photo on lock screen but not on Home screen.
The Home screen wallpaper came later in iPhone 3GS.

No you can not change the homescreen background on the 3G. The processor the 3G has just does not support it. Yes you could jailbreak it but most people have found that it slows their phones down and opens them up to exploitation from hackers. The 3G is slow enough with 4.2.1 on it and making it even slower would make you want to throw the thing out.
